The Decline of Community in Zinacantan: Economy, Public Life, and Social Stratification, 1960-1987
Frank Cancian
This anthropological study shows how national prosperity and government expansion in Mexico in the 1970's transformed a relatively closed peasant community into a more outwardly connected, socially differentiated society marked by dissension and conflict.
